The
Chesterford Steam-Up is an annual event held in the village streets
to raise money for local charities. It is a very popular event and
attracts a
great number of people each year.
This year was the 17th Steam-Up to be held in the village, and as usual many village clubs and societies took part.
Entertainment included face painting, a street organ, vintage cars, lorries and farm tractors, and steam engines of all sizes. A Jumble Sale was held in the School Hall, and there was an old style fairground on Horse River Green with a cakewalk, helter skelter, swingboats, roundabouts and sideshows.
There was plenty of food available, with both village pubs doing barbecues, and several food stalls on South Street.
With
an aerial flypast provided by the French Red Arrows, and the rain
delaying its arrival till much later, a great day was had by all.
